https://bugs.kde.org/show_bug.cgi?id=362535 Pali Rohár changed: What|Removed |Added Status|CONFIRMED |RESOLVED Version Fixed In||16.12 Latest Commit||http://commits.kde.org/kope ||te/19957f9324a5ae45bcb1479f ||1bb017efa77d0aa7 Resolution|--- |FIXED --- Comment #12 from Pali Rohár --- Git commit 19957f9324a5ae45bcb1479f1bb017efa77d0aa7 by Pali Rohár. Committed on 21/11/2016 at 23:31. Pushed by pali into branch 'master'. When updating OTR GUI icon properly set OTR instance tag Without configured instance tag libotr library does not encrypt sent messages and moreover it even does not report any error that message was not encrypted. This should fix a bug when OTR "encrypted" icon is shown in GUI and libotr itself does not want to encrypt messages. It happened when Kopete window with active OTR session was closed and after that again opened. FIXED-IN: 16.12 M +4-0plugins/otr/otrlchatinterface.cpp http://commits.kde.org/kopete/19957f9324a5ae45bcb1479f1bb017efa77d0aa7 -- You are receiving this mail because: You are watching all bug changes.

https://bugs.kde.org/show_bug.cgi?id=362535 OlafLostViking changed: What|Removed |Added Status|NEEDSINFO |UNCONFIRMED Resolution|WAITINGFORINFO |--- --- Comment #9 from OlafLostViking --- Sure thing: 1. start kopete and go online 2. open XML console for the jabber account used for testing 3. send unencrypted message from another account/server/VM via KTP 3a. as expected: unencrypted message in XML console 4. initiate OTR session from the other client (KTP) 4a. Kopete and KTP show that the channel is encrypted 4b. messages sent in both directions are encrypted ===> This is the important step. Closing the window triggers the problem. 5. close chat window in kopete 6. reopen it and send message 6a. Kopete still claims that the channel is encrypted 6b. KTP correctly says the received message is unencrypted 6c. the XML console confirms this as I can read the sent message in clear text This also "works" when using Converstations on an Android phone instead of KTP as partner. -- You are receiving this mail because: You are watching all bug changes.

https://bugs.kde.org/show_bug.cgi?id=362535 --- Comment #1 from OlafLostViking --- Looks like Kopete is internally killing the _encryption_ on the sending side as soon as I close the chat window/tab without informing the other side of that. It can still _decrypt_ messages from the other client. I saw it first with a Pidgin contact and verified it now with a Conversations client. -- You are receiving this mail because: You are watching all bug changes.
